Skip to content

chore: update deps#165

Merged
FliPPeDround merged 1 commit intomainfrom
chore/update-deps
Jan 12, 2026
Merged

chore: update deps#165
FliPPeDround merged 1 commit intomainfrom
chore/update-deps

Conversation

@FliPPeDround
Copy link
Member

@FliPPeDround FliPPeDround commented Jan 12, 2026

Update dependencies

Summary by CodeRabbit

  • Chores
    • Updated multiple development dependencies to their latest versions, including TypeScript support utilities, Vue compiler tooling, and UI framework packages, for improved stability and compatibility.

✏️ Tip: You can customize this high-level summary in your review settings.

@coderabbitai
Copy link

coderabbitai bot commented Jan 12, 2026

📝 Walkthrough

Walkthrough

Three dependency versions bumped across template configuration files: uview-pro updated to ^0.4.13, @types/node to ^25.0.6, vue-tsc to ^3.2.2, and @iconify-json/carbon to ^1.2.16. No logic changes.

Changes

Cohort / File(s) Summary
UI Template Dependencies
packages/core/template/UI/uview-pro/package.json
Bump uview-pro from ^0.4.12 to ^0.4.13
TypeScript Config Dependencies
packages/core/template/config/typescript/package.json
Bump @types/node from ^25.0.3 to ^25.0.6; bump vue-tsc from ^3.2.1 to ^3.2.2
UnoCSS Module Dependencies
packages/core/template/module/unocss/package.json
Bump @iconify-json/carbon from ^1.2.15 to ^1.2.16

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~3 minutes

Possibly related PRs

Suggested labels

size/M

Poem

🐰 Hop along with versions new,
Dependencies refreshed, tried and true,
^0.4.13 hops up the tree,
Types and icons dance with glee! 🌟

🚥 Pre-merge checks | ✅ 3
✅ Passed checks (3 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Title check ✅ Passed The title 'chore: update deps' accurately summarizes the main change: updating dependencies across multiple package.json files.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.


📜 Recent review details

Configuration used: defaults

Review profile: CHILL

Plan: Pro

📥 Commits

Reviewing files that changed from the base of the PR and between 346041b and e9879bd.

📒 Files selected for processing (3)
  • packages/core/template/UI/uview-pro/package.json
  • packages/core/template/config/typescript/package.json
  • packages/core/template/module/unocss/package.json
⏰ Context from checks skipped due to timeout of 90000ms. You can increase the timeout in your CodeRabbit configuration to a maximum of 15 minutes (900000ms). (20)
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(--ts, -e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Pla...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: test (-e, -p import -p pages -p layouts -p manifest -p filePlatform -p root -p componentPlacehold...
  • GitHub Check: stable - i686-pc-windows-msvc - node@20
  • GitHub Check: stable - x86_64-apple-darwin - node@20
  • GitHub Check: stable - x86_64-pc-windows-msvc - node@20
  • GitHub Check: stable - aarch64-pc-windows-msvc - node@20
  • GitHub Check: build (20.x, windows-latest)
🔇 Additional comments (3)
packages/core/template/module/unocss/package.json (1)

3-3: LGTM!

Patch version bump for the Carbon icon set. This is a low-risk update.

packages/core/template/UI/uview-pro/package.json (1)

3-3: LGTM!

Patch version bump for the uview-pro UI library.

packages/core/template/config/typescript/package.json (1)

6-9: LGTM!

Patch version bumps for TypeScript type definitions and Vue TypeScript compiler. Both are devDependencies with low-risk updates.


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

@FliPPeDround FliPPeDround merged commit 509e6e1 into main Jan 12, 2026
46 checks passed
@coderabbitai coderabbitai bot mentioned this pull request Jan 19, 2026
@coderabbitai coderabbitai bot mentioned this pull request Feb 2,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ant